| 1981 |
|
• The foundation is laid for the new Main Building of the Bank.
• The subsidiary Company ''Alpha Computers A.E.'' is established. It is the first company of the Group to introduce the word ''Alpha'' in the vocabulary of the Bank. A few years later (1986), it will become the first company to provide leasing services in Greece. In 1989, it will be renamed as ''Alpha Leasing S.A.''

| 1982 |
|
• The Bank is the first to enter the age of the automation of transactions by introducing the on-line/real-time system that offers its Clients the possibility for automatic withdrawal and deposit of money.
• The new multi-storey building of the Bank in Thessaloniki is inaugurated. It is the seat of the Northern Greece Branch Division and also the most important hub of the electronic network.
• A subsidiary portfolio Company is founded under the name ''Sperchoghia A.E.''.
• The structure of the General Management of the Bank is expanded with the establishment of the position of Deputy General Manager who will assist the General Manager in his duties. This position is assumed by Constantine A. Kyriacopoulos, until then an Executive of the Commercial Bank.

| 1983 |
|
• The first Automated Teller Machines (ATMs) are installed and the first network of automated transactions in Greece is created.
• The subsidiary Company ''Credit Investments A.E.'', a portfolio investment company, is founded.
